Adrian Grenier Braves The Snow To Help Fight Hunger

Filed under: donations, events: nyc — Michael Andre d'Estries @ 11:51 pm

grenier_charDespite the blustery December weather that hit earlier today in New York City, Adrian Grenier nonetheless was busy lending a hand for charity. The 32-year old actor rode shotgun in City Harvest’s new hybrid truck and helped pick up unused food from local bakeries and restaurants in NYC. The final destination was the drop-off at the Yorkville Common Pantry, which works to fight hunger.

Grenier was lending his time on behalf of Feeding America, the nation’s leading domestic hunger-relief charity. Earlier in the week, the Entourage star hosted the annual Charity:Water Ball  to raise money for the organization’s work bringing clean and safe drinking water to people in developing nations.
